That feeling when everyone is happy to see you when you get home.... priceless. by RazTheExplorer in NoMansSkyTheGame

[–]RazTheExplorer[S] 5 points6 points  (0 children)

When you find a dreadnought attacking another freighter, take out the ENGINES, and then take out the shield generators and the fuel rods in the two trenches. The dreadnought will surrender, and you can then board it and tell them "I am the captain now."
